Do Vape Products Expire? Shelf Life and Storage Tips Explained

Yes, vape products do expire. E-liquids typically last between one to two years from the manufacture date. Check the expiration date on the bottle and observe for changes in color or taste. Proper storage in a cool, dark place can help extend their shelf life. Expired vape products can degrade in quality, leading to a poor vaping experience and potential health risks.
